    ABOUT THE POSITION

    This is a lead position that reports to the Recreation Manager. An incumbent in this classification is expected to perform a full range of duties and responsibilities under general supervision involving the management of Contract Instructors, the production of The Orbit seasonal guidebook, the supervision and implementation of seasonal programming which includes; Day Camp and Aquatics programming, and the oversight of the Volunteer program and other major functions of the Parks & Recreation Department including but not limited to supporting with the execution of City Wide Special Events and the ability to plan, organize and coordinate comprehensive recreation programs in the City.

    EXAMPLES OF 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

    The following examples are intended to describe the general nature and level of work performed by persons assigned to this classification.

    • Determine program content and the methods used in providing community recreation offerings.
    • Hold regular staff meetings to discuss and evaluate program techniques and content.
    • Prepare and administer the budget for particular program components.
    • Plan programming for seasonal activities which include Summer Day Camp and Aquatics
    • Respond to inquiries or requests for service from interested community groups and citizens.
    • Plan and supervise a program of aquatics, senior citizen programs, contract classes or other recreation specialties involving the supervision of group instructors and leaders in the planning of activities and special events.
    • Prepare and submit a variety of reports and memoranda on a number of recreation-related subjects.
    • Evaluates programs and makes recommendations for changes.
    • Perform other related duties as assigned.


    QUALIFICATIONS

    Any combination equivalent to experience and education that could likely provide the required skills, knowledge and abilities would be qualifying. A typical way to obtain the skills, knowledge and abilities would be:

    Education: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university with major work in Recreation or related field.

    Experience: Three (3) years of recreation leadership including at least two years in a supervisory capacity.

    Knowledge of: Recreation, cultural and social needs of the community; procedures for planning, implementing and maintaining a variety of recreation and leisure time activities and programs; current trends and practices in recreation programs; methods of planning and organizing City wide special events; public building operations and learning center facilities.

    Ability to: Design, develop and implement recreations programs suited to the needs of the community; analyze, interpret and explain department policies and procedures; supervise, train and evaluate subordinates; elicit community and organizational support for programs; communicate clearly and concisely, orally and in writing; develop, present and administer a budget for a particular program area; establish and maintain effective working relationships with public groups, agencies and the media, and others contacted in the course of work.

    License: Due to the performance of field duties, a valid California Class C Driver’s License or the ability to utilize an alternative method of transportation when needed to carry out job-related essential functions and an acceptable driving record at the time of appointment and throughout employment is required.

    ABOUT THE CITY

    The City of Downey, population 113,000, in an area of 12.5 square miles is situated 12 miles southeast of the Los Angeles Civic Center, five miles from Orange County, and about 10 miles from the beautiful Pacific coastline. Conveniently located near several major freeways, the City is an ideal home base from which to take advantage of the business resources and hundreds of cultural and recreational activities in Southern California. Downey offers a wide range of housing opportunities.

    All parks and many recreation facilities are operated by the City. Almost 100 acres are devoted to 11 area parks, including fishing lakes at Wilderness Park, the Independence Park Tennis Center, and fitness courses at Furman and Apollo parks. For golf enthusiasts, there is the 18-hole Rio Hondo Golf Course or the Los Amigos Golf Course run by the County of Los Angeles.

    CITY GOVERNMENT

    The City of Downey is a Charter city operating under the Council-Manager form of municipal government. The City Council is the legislative and policy-making body for the City. Council Members are elected at-large for four-year, overlapping terms of office.
